onget wrote:There is no it in equipment and consumables.
Consumables change the way you deal with danger, and different consumables help you deal with them in a different way. This is less obvious when you have stacks of all of them (standard situation in mid/endgame), but much more obvious in earlygame. Blink is one of the strongest ones, but maybe you want to conserve it, fear works greatly on some enemies but doesn't work on others, invis is my favorite but it has its limitations, healing are the banal safe ones, maybe you quaff haste dependign on encounter or even quaff might and go for the kill.
Equipment - it's a rather exceptional example, but it's a real one from one of my games. Started as HuAK with pitiful Str. Found the +10 gold dragon armour of Agnosticism (worn) {rElec rPois rF+ rC+ Dam+6} on D:4. Spent most of Lair with negative EV (but nothing could hurt me anyway). Really fun game.
Edit: also I've used Maxwell's Coffin in several games and won those. It obviously very much influenced my characters' development.
